Transaction 5b40f995fd79778d568eab978be531dc79c4b3f01fb38abf0d90e788bc3c8b79

1 Input
2 Outputs
  • 5b40f995fd79778d568eab978be531dc79c4b3f01fb38abf0d90e788bc3c8b79:0
  • value  1443107
    address  3DQaGFY4cKyAQentJn7Fym5zoumFFugtPp
  • 5b40f995fd79778d568eab978be531dc79c4b3f01fb38abf0d90e788bc3c8b79:1
  • value  635622
    address  1JLX3G6rvcS5FzfV3tJiiSSwBWJiqxm7SE